Index: components/data_use_measurement/core/data_use_measurement.cc |
diff --git a/components/data_use_measurement/core/data_use_measurement.cc b/components/data_use_measurement/core/data_use_measurement.cc |
index 2c7b0b3f0e66b83d3de1b752519916a8a4d74f45..1a44598562fb987e38004c9fe2c28a3b9b0fcd68 100644 |
--- a/components/data_use_measurement/core/data_use_measurement.cc |
+++ b/components/data_use_measurement/core/data_use_measurement.cc |
@@ -117,6 +117,8 @@ void DataUseMeasurement::OnBeforeURLRequest(net::URLRequest* request) { |
service_name = DataUseUserData::ServiceName::DOMAIN_RELIABILITY; |
} else if (gaia::RequestOriginatedFromGaia(*request)) { |
service_name = DataUseUserData::ServiceName::GAIA; |
+ } else if (url_request_classifier_->IsServiceWorkerRequest(*request)) { |
+ service_name = DataUseUserData::ServiceName::SERVICE_WORKER; |
} |
data_use_user_data = new DataUseUserData(service_name, CurrentAppState()); |